Automotive Safety: The Evolution and Impact of Traction Control Systems

How Have Traction Control Systems Progressed?

Traction control systems (TCS) have witnessed evolutionary advancements since their introduction. Initially, these systems were basic, mechanically driven, and mainly focused on preventing wheel spin during acceleration. With enhanced technological capabilities, they have evolved into sophisticated, electronic stability systems that control wheel speed in multiple driving conditions, significantly improving vehicle safety.

What Role Do TCS Play in Automotive Safety?

TCS have notably improved automotive safety, reducing risk associated with loss of road grip when driving at high speeds. They work in tandem with safety features, such as Anti-lock Brake Systems (ABS), controlled by electronic sensors to maximize tire-road contact under varying driving conditions. TCS are essential in maintaining control during sudden changes in vehicle direction or speed, contributing to a substantial reduction in road accidents.

What is the Impact of TCS on the Automotive Market?

The demand for TCS continues to grow in the automotive industry, as consumers place high value on vehicle safety features. From a market perspective, manufacturers incorporating advanced TCS into their car models have seen a competitive edge. Moreover, regulations requiring these systems as standard in new cars have further stimulated the market, leading to higher adoption rates of TCS in vehicles globally.
